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 48727 - Vector games do not work with >=XMame-0.81.1 using NVidia GL drivers
Summary: Vector games do not work with >=XMame-0.81.1 using NVidia GL drivers
Status: RESOLVED UPSTREAM
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: [OLD] Games (show other bugs)
Hardware: x86 Linux
: High normal (vote)
Assignee: Gentoo Games
URL: http://bugzilla.mess.org/show_bug.cgi...
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2004-04-22 14:00 UTC by Joe Roberts
Modified: 2004-08-22 23:30 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Joe Roberts 2004-04-22 14:00:12 UTC
I tried this with both XMame 0.81.1 and 0.80.1:

nvidia-glx - 1.0.5336-r2
nvidia-kernel - 1.0.5336-r2

Fails at all color depths (-b xx).

Without -noartwork switch, xmame window launches and is black/empty with no text, and no keys.  Pressing TAB here causes a segmentation fault.

With -noartwork switch, xmame window launches with xmame info screen (Game information, and "Press Any Key.")  Pressing a key at this point results in a black/empty screen.  Tab will bring up the configuration menu, here, however.

When aborting the blank screen with ESC, I get a gentle exit with no errors:

GLmame v0.94 - the_peace_version , by Sven Goethel, http://www.jausoft.com, sgoethel@jausoft.com,
based upon GLmame v0.6 driver for xmame, written by Mike Oliphant


> xmame -noartwork ./astdelux.zip

(All vector games are broken, however).

I tried re-emerging xmame, as well as the NVIDIA GLX package.  Still no luck.

GLmame v0.94 - the_peace_version , by Sven Goethel, http://www.jausoft.com, sgoethel@jausoft.com,
based upon GLmame v0.6 driver for xmame, written by Mike Oliphant

GLINFO: loaded OpenGL library libGL.so!
GLINFO: loaded GLU    library libGLU.so!
GLINFO: glPolygonOffsetEXT (3): not implemented !

GLINFO: OpenGL Driver Information:
        vendor: NVIDIA Corporation,
        renderer GeForce2 MX/PCI/SSE,
        version 1.4.1 NVIDIA 53.36
GLINFO: GLU Driver Information:
        version 1.3
GLINFO: You have an OpenGL >= 1.2 capable drivers, GOOD (16bpp is ok !)
GLINFO: swapxy=0, flipx=0, flipy=0
GLINFO: xgl_resize to 640x480
GLINFO: Offering colors=0, depth=16, rgb 0xF800, 0x7C0, 0x3E (true color mode)
GLINFO: Using bit blit to map color indices !!
Using 16bpp video mode
GLINFO: totalcolors = 32768 / colortable size= 32768,
        depth = 15 alphablending=1,
        use_mod_ctable=1
        useColorIndex=0
GLINFO (vec): min 0/70, max 1040/950, cent 520/510,
         vecsize 1040x880
GLINFO (vec): beamer size 1.000000
info: setting fragsize to 512, numfrags to 5
info: fragsize = 1024, numfrags = 8
warning: obtained fragsize/numfrags differs too much from requested
   you may wish to adjust the bufsize setting in your xmamerc file, or try
   timer-based audio by adding -timer to your command line
info: audiodevice /dev/dsp set to 16bit linear mono 22050Hz
info: sysdep_dsp: using oss plugin
info: sysdep_mixer: using oss plugin
GLINFO: line_len = 864, raw_line_len= 1344
GLINFO: texture-usage 1*width=1024, 1*height=512
GLINFO: 16bpp color palette lookup bitblit


Reproducible: Always
Steps to Reproduce:
xmame -noartwork ./astdelux.zip



Actual Results:  
XMame info screen comes up for game with "Press Any Key."  I press any key, and 
a blank/black screen appears.  This behavior is the same in fullscreen or 
windowed mode.

Expected Results:  
Another screeen with ROM license, or game itself should start.
Comment 1 SpanKY gentoo-dev 2004-04-22 23:10:53 UTC
*** Bug 48759 has been marked as a duplicate of this bug. ***
Comment 2 Mr. Bones. (RETIRED) gentoo-dev 2004-06-07 23:32:59 UTC
Same problem with 0.82.1?
Comment 3 Joe Roberts 2004-06-08 03:03:05 UTC
Unfortunately, yes, the problem continues with 0.82.1, except now:

earom ctrl: 00:00
cpu #0 (PC=000079C7): unmapped program memory byte write to 00002004 = FE

(The second line repeats over and over, forever) - this occurs after the "Press Any Key" screen.
Comment 4 Mr. Bones. (RETIRED) gentoo-dev 2004-06-17 21:23:47 UTC
This still happens with 0.83.1 btw.  Continues to work fine with the SDL version
of xmame.
Comment 5 Mr. Bones. (RETIRED) gentoo-dev 2004-06-21 16:53:13 UTC
Added upstream bugzilla link so I can find it easier.
Comment 6 Andrew Bevitt 2004-07-16 23:40:09 UTC
Try the 6106 drivers perhaps?
Comment 7 SpanKY gentoo-dev 2004-08-22 23:30:30 UTC
being handled in mess bugzilla